1st time Jeep Owner - 2020 Jeep Gladiator Sport S with Max Tow, Tan Interior, Aux Switches, Cold Weather Group, 7" Radio Group, Dual Tops, Active Safety Group, Hardtop Headliners, Cargo Management with under seat lockable storage, Alpine Premium Sound, Roll up Tonneau Cover, 8 speed Automatic and Spray in Bed liner.

Ordered Sept 5, 2019 took delivery October 25, 2019
